COVID delay saved Mercedes from struggling engine

Mercedes' former engine chief Andy Cowell said the COVID-enforced delay to the 2020 season came at the perfect time for the team. The Australian Grand Prix was set to kick-off the 2020 Formula 1 season in its traditional slot, but as the effects of the global pandemic started to set in and positive cases were recorded in the paddock, the event was cancelled just hours before FP1. A blanket ban was then enforced by the FIA forcing teams to shut down their factories for 63 days and 49 days for engine suppliers, with the season then rescheduled to start with the Austrian Grand Prix on July 5.
